我可以在RFID标签上写入或修改数据吗?

kie*_*wic 28 hardware rfid

也许我的问题会在论坛中丢失,但有人在使用RFID标签吗?我知道我可以阅读它们,但我可以编写或修改内部数据吗?有谁知道我在哪里可以找到更多这方面的信息?

Kyl*_*wry 50

RFID标准:


  • 125 Khz(低频)标签是一次写入/多次读取,通常只包含一个小的(永久性)唯一标识号.

  • 13.56 Mhz(高频)标签通常是读/写,除了预设(永久)唯一ID号外,它们通常可以存储大约1到2千字节的数据.

  • 860-960 Mhz(超高频)标签通常是可读/写的,除了预设(永久)唯一ID 外,还可以有更大的信息存储容量(我认为64 KB是当前可用于无源标签的最高值)数.

更多信息


可以锁定大多数读/写标签,以防止进一步写入标签内部存储器中的特定数据块,同时保持其他块未锁定.然而,不同的标签制造商使他们的标签不同.

根据您的应用,您可能需要使用特定于制造商的协议对自己的微控制器进行编程,以与嵌入式RFID读/写模块连接.这肯定比购买完整的RFID读/写单元便宜很多,因为它们可能花费数千美元.使用自定义解决方案,您可以构建自己的单元,只需200美元即可实现您想要的功能.

链接


RFID Journal

RFID玩具(书籍)网站

SkyTek - RFID阅读器制造公司(您可以通过Mouser等第三方零售商和批发商购买他们的产品)

Trossen Robotics - 您可以从这里购买RFID标签和读卡器(125 Khz和13.56 Mhz)等等


Jon*_*lle 5

大约 7-8 年前,我使用 Mifare Classic (ISO 14443A) 卡进行了一些开发。您可以读写卡的所有扇区,IIRC 唯一不能更改的数据是序列号。当时我们使用了飞利浦半导体的专有库。该卡的命令接口与 ISO 7816-4(与标准智能卡一起使用)非常相似。

如果您从事开发工作,我建议您查看OpenPCD 平台

这也某些RFID 卡中的加密功能有关。


Cod*_*ous 2

有些RFID芯片是可读写的,大多数是只读的。您可以通过检查数据表来了解您的芯片是否是只读的。